Sensory neurons are nerve cells that are triggered by sensory input from your surroundings. Let's say you touch a hot object with your fingers. This causes sensory neurons to activate and transmit messages to the rest of the nervous system about what they've discovered (which is that the object is hot).

Two of the four major divisions in the geologic time scale are the Archean eon and proterozoic eon.
<u>Explanation:</u>
The Arcean eon is dated from 3900 million years ago to 2500 million years ago. It was in this period the oldest known rocks were deposited. At that time the atmosphere of earth was composed of gases like methane, carbon monoxide, ammonia etc.
The Proterozoic eon is dated from 2500 million years ago to 540 million years ago. It was by the end of Proterozoic era that the Eukaryotas came into existence.
There are some similarities and differences between Archean eon and Proterozoic eon. Stromatolites formed by the colonies of cyanobacteria lived in both the eras. This is one similarity between both the eras.
The weather in the Archean era was hot and wet while the climate and weather of proterozoic era was different from this. Proterozoic era experienced two ice ages.

The corpus spongiosum is a mass of tissue present in the under part of the penis (male sexual structure) that is actively responsible for erection of the penis. The corpus spongiosum, in conjunction with the corpus carvernosa works to maintain erection of the penis in males.
During sexual arousal, the corpus spongiosum, which surrounds the urethra (passage for urine and semen) helps keep the urethra open for semen to be released while the carvernosa becomes filled with blood. This constant flow of blood into the carvernosa makes the penis enlarge and assume an erect position.

Ribosomes are special because they are found in both prokaryotes and eukaryotes. While a structure such as a nucleus is only found in eukaryotes, every cell needs ribosomes to manufacture proteins. Since there are no membrane-bound organelles in prokaryotes, the ribosomes float free in the cytosol.
